|
|
(No se muestran 262 ediciones intermedias de 37 usuarios) |
Línea 1: |
Línea 1: |
− | Bienvenido al wiki de la asignatura de Sistemas Operativos del departamento de Lenguajes y Sistemas Informáticos de la Universidad de Sevilla. ¡Regístrate y contribuye! | + | Bienvenido al wiki de la asignatura de Sistemas Operativos del departamento de Lenguajes y Sistemas Informáticos de la Universidad de Sevilla. |
| | | |
− | = Unidades didácticas =
| + | Accede al contenido de la asignatura según tu titulación: |
| | | |
− | A continuación encontrarás las unidades didácticas que forman parte de la asignatura.
| + | * [[Grado de Ingeniería de Software]] |
− | | + | * [[Grado de Ingeniería de Software|Grado de Tecnología de Información]] |
− | == Introducción a los Sistemas Operativos ==
| + | * [[Material teoría|Grado de Ingeniería de Computadores]] |
− | | + | * [[Software Engineering Degree]] (in English) |
− | * [[Qué es un Sistema Operativo|Qué es un sistema operativo]]
| |
− | * [[Introducción histórica|Una introducción histórica a los sistemas operativos]]
| |
− | * [[Tipos de Sistemas Operativos|Tipos de sistemas operativos]]
| |
− | | |
− | == Fundamentos de Sistemas Operativos ==
| |
− | | |
− | * [[Conceptos básicos|Conceptos básicos]]
| |
− | * [[Componentes básicos de un sistema operativo|Componentes básicos de un sistema operativo]]
| |
− | * [[Llamadas al sistema|Llamadas al sistema]]
| |
− | * [[Modelos de Diseño de Sistemas Operativos|Modelos de diseño de sistemas operativos]]
| |
− | * [[Ejercicios fundamentos Sistemas Operativos|Ejercicios]]
| |
− | | |
− | == Procesos ==
| |
− | * [[Multiprogramación|La multiprogramación]]
| |
− | * [[Estados de los procesos|Estados de los procesos]]
| |
− | * [[Planificador de procesos|El planificador de procesos]]
| |
− | * [[Comportamiento de los procesos|El comportamiento de los procesos según el planificador]]
| |
− | * [[Bloque de control de procesos|El bloque de control del proceso]]
| |
− | * [[Conmutación de procesos|La conmutación de procesos]]
| |
− | * [[Hilos|Hilos]]
| |
− | * [[Ejercicios Procesos|Ejercicios]]
| |
− | | |
− | == Planificación de Procesos ==
| |
− | * [[Planificación de procesos|La planificación de procesos]]
| |
− | * [[Índices de evaluación|Índices de evaluación de la planificación de procesos]]
| |
− | * [[Criterios de planificación|Criterios de planificación]]
| |
− | * [[Planificadores de sistemas operativos existentes|Planificadores de sistemas operativos existentes]] | |
− | * [[Ejercicios planificación de procesos|Ejercicios]]
| |
− | | |
− | == Otros aspectos relacionados con la planificación de procesos ==
| |
− | | |
− | * [[Planificación de procesos de tiempo real|La planificación de procesos de tiempo real]] | |
− | * [[Planificación en sistemas multiprocesadores|La planificación de procesos en sistemas multiprocesadores]]
| |
− | * [[Ejercicios otros aspectos de la planificación|Ejercicios]] | |
− | | |
− | == Concurrencia de procesos ==
| |
− | | |
− | * [[Concurrencia de procesos|Concurrencia de procesos]]
| |
− | * [[Mecanismos de sincronización|Control optimista y pesimista de la concurrencia]] | |
− | * [[Cerrojos|Cerrojos]]
| |
− | * [[Ejercicio de concurrencia de procesos|Ejercicios]]
| |
− | | |
− | == Semáforos y comunicación ==
| |
− | | |
− | * [[Semáforos|Semáforos]]
| |
− | * [[Monitores|Monitores]]
| |
− | * [[Mensajería|Mensajería]]
| |
− | * [[Ejercicios sincronización y comunicación|Ejercicios]]
| |
− | | |
− | == Interbloqueo ==
| |
− | | |
− | * [[Definición de interbloqueo|Definición]]
| |
− | * [[Condiciones para el interbloqueo y estrategias de resolución|Modelado y Estrategias]]
| |
− | * [[Algoritmo para averiguar interbloqueo]]
| |
− | * [[Ejercicios]]
| |
− | | |
− | == BLOQUE II: Administración de memoria contigua ==
| |
− | | |
− | * [[Introducción|Introducción]]
| |
− | * [[SO monoprogramables|SO monoprogramables]]
| |
− | * [[SO multiprogramables con particiones fijas|SO multiprogramables con particiones fijas]]
| |
− | * [[SO multiprogramables con particiones variables|SO multiprogramables con particiones variables]]
| |
− | | |
− | == Segmentación y paginación ==
| |
− | | |
− | *[[Segmentacion|Segmentación]]
| |
− | *[[Paginación|Paginación]]
| |
− | *[[Sistema combinado|Sistema combinado]]
| |
− | | |
− | == Memoria virtual ==
| |
− | | |
− | *[[Intro|Introducción]]
| |
− | *[[Criterios de reemplazo|Criterios de reemplazo]]
| |
− | | |
− | == Entrada/Salida ==
| |
− | | |
− | *[[EstructuraES|Estructura dispositivo E/S]]
| |
− | *[[GestionES|Modos de gestionar dispositivos E/S]]
| |
− | *[[Diseño modular E/S|Diseño modular E/S]]
| |
− | | |
− | == Gestión L/E ==
| |
− | | |
− | *[[Discos Magnéticos|Discos Magnéticos]]
| |
− | *[[MejorasTiempoBusqueda|Mejoras en el tiempo de búsqueda]]
| |
− | *[[Tipos de Errores |Tipos de Errores]]
| |
Bienvenido al wiki de la asignatura de Sistemas Operativos del departamento de Lenguajes y Sistemas Informáticos de la Universidad de Sevilla.